The title hepta-nuclear alkoxido(oxido)vanadium(V) oxide cluster complex, [V(CHO)O(CHN)]·CHCN, was obtained by the reaction of [VO(CHN)] with 4--butyl-cyclo-hexa-nol (mixture of and ) in a mixed CHCl/CHCN solvent. The complex has a VON core with approximately symmetry, which is composed of two VO tetra-hedra, two VO octa-hedra and three VON octa-hedra. In the crystal, these complexes are linked together by weak inter-molecular C-H⋯O hydrogen bonds between the 4,4'-di--butyl-2,2'-bi-pyridine ligand and the VON core, forming a one-dimensional network along the -axis direction. Besides the complex, the asymmetric unit contains one CHCN solvent mol-ecule. The contribution of other disordered solvent mol-ecules to the scattering was removed using the SQUEEZE option in [Spek (2015 ▸). . C, 9-18]. The unknown solvent mol-ecules are not considered in the chemical formula and other crystal data.
